Background
The punching die is a special process equipment for processing materials (metal or nonmetal) into parts (or semi-finished products) in cold punching processing, and is called a cold punching die (commonly called a cold stamping die), wherein the punching is a pressure processing method for obtaining required parts by applying pressure to the materials by using a die arranged on a press machine at room temperature to separate or plastically deform the materials.

In the figure: the device comprises a base plate 1, a lower die 2, an upper die 3, a fixing unit 4, a mounting plate 41, a telescopic rod 42, a gear 43, a rack 44, a fixing plate 45, a supporting plate 46, a limiting block 5, a limiting rod 6, a fixing hole 7, a rubber pad 8, a mounting seat 9, a bolt 10, a fixing column 11 and a rotating rod 12.

When in use: fix bottom plate 1 on stamping equipment through fixed orifices 7, cup joint mount pad 9 on the pressure head and rotate bolt 10 and fix mount pad 9 on the pressure head, place the both ends of FFC stiffening plate on two backup pads 46, promote dwang 12 and make fixed column 11 rotate, thereby make gear 43 rotate and drive rack 44 downstream, make fixed plate 45 along telescopic link 42's direction downstream, make fixed plate 45 and backup pad 46 cooperation fix the both ends of FFC stiffening plate, it removes to drive last mould 3 through the punching press head, make last mould 3 along the direction downstream of gag lever post 6, it carries out the punching press to make last mould 3 pair the FFC stiffening plate with lower mould 2.
